Abstract
The open a kind of praseodymium yellow color ceramic ink jet of the present invention oozes colored ink and preparation method thereof.By mass percentage, praseodymium yellow color ceramic ink jet oozes colored ink and includes 65 ~ 75% organic praseodymium salt, 25 ~ 35% solvents and 0.1 ~ 2% auxiliary agent;Described organic praseodymium salt is carboxylic acid praseodymium.The present invention uses organic praseodymium salt to ooze colored ink to prepare praseodymium yellow color, and 1.5mm is controlled for the ink bleed degree of depth 0.1, and color development is bright-coloured, within 8 months, never degenerating, at ink 40 DEG C, viscosity is 20 25mPa s, surface tension 25 29mN/m, there is good Ink Jet Printing Performance, can use on various main flow shower nozzles.

Background technology
In recent years, ink-jet technology experiencings rapid development.Ceramic ink is as the important materials of inkjet printing, at home and abroad
The research of ceramic ink is deepened continuously by ceramic industry.In Guangzhou ceramic industry exhibition in 2015, ink product is further to function
Property and special-effect stride forward.Ooze colored ink and become the bright spot of ink enterprise rollout.
First Mei Gao company of Italy carried out technological cooperation and assistance to Nobel's pottery in 2014 in Chinese market, became
Merit is proposed oozes colored ink tile product, is also ink-jet polished bricks.2015, Mei Gao company was planned, step by step to covering Na
Li Sha, east roc two domestic large-scale brand pottery enterprise cooperate, and exploitation number oozes colored ink tile product.At present, ink-jet polishing
The common following two of brickwork skill:
Technique one: in cloth → adobe, the thin material → press of secondary cloth → dry → spray is oozed colored ink+spray permeation-promoter → kiln and burnt till
→ polishing;
Technique two: cloth → press → be dried → pouring glaze → be dried → spray is oozed colored ink+spray permeation-promoter → kiln and burnt till → throw
Light.
Ooze colored ink be primarily referred to as organic metal salt be dissolved in solvent is prepared from can be on ceramic matrix the one of color development
Class ink, such ink is permeable to the degree of depth of base material 0.6-1.0mm by penetrating agent.Ooze colored ink and have following four the most excellent
Gesture: one, ceramic tile pattern third dimension is higher, superficial makings can be the finest and the smoothest true to nature, close to the texture of lithotome;Two, solve
Common ink is in a difficult problem for the color color developments such as redness, Lycoperdon polymorphum Vitt, black;Three, it makes the pattern texture of polished bricks abundanter, Mohs
Hardness has reached 5.5-6, more wear-resisting than the full throwing glaze of current trend;Four, common polished bricks wants jettisoning ceramic tile table when polishing
The raw material of face more than 1mm, and use the polishing thickness oozing the produced polished bricks of colored ink to be about 0.1-0.3mm, significantly drop
Low polishing thickness, decreases the discharge of solid waste, waste residue.
CN 104761952 A refer to use 2 ethyl hexanoic acid chromium and 2 ethyl hexanoic acid titanium to ooze colored ink to prepare yellow.
But using above method to there is problems in that the deep dimness of yellow color development, color is the most bright-coloured, makes ink color development colour gamut narrow;Two kinds
Different organic salt is different due to preparation technology, and the impurity of residual etc. can cause two kinds of salt to interact, and ultimately results in ink and holds
Easily crystallize blocking shower nozzle;The preparation of 2 ethyl hexanoic acid chromium and use can produce chromium and be unfavorable for environmental protection, and price is high.
Therefore, prior art has yet to be improved and developed.

The present invention also provides for a kind of praseodymium yellow color ceramic ink jet and oozes the preparation method of colored ink, and it includes step:
1), organic praseodymium salt, solvent are put in enamel stirred tank with auxiliary agent according to quantity, little with 85 revs/min of stirrings 3 under room temperature
Time;
2), sampling detection viscosity;
3), viscosity measurements qualified after use 1 micron of filter element filter, pack after filtration.
Can sampling Detection viscosity, surface tension be finally physical and chemical performance with density etc..
In the present invention, in ink composition, chromophore component is preferably one matter, it is to avoid untoward reaction between multicomponent, it is to avoid
Using raw material disadvantageous to environmental protection, organic praseodymium salt color development is more bright-coloured;Praseodymium yellow oozes colored ink not to be sent out in common fabric
Color, but by adjusting the composition of fabric, and (nano silicon oxide is with nano oxidized to add special nano material in fabric
Zirconium), utilize the characteristic strong adsorption of nano material high-specific surface area parcel to ooze colored ink, thus at high temperature parcel color development becomes
Point, the most eclipsed after burning till, color development is bright-coloured pure.

Above example application process follows the steps below:
1, color development test: by ooze colored ink by 100% gray level printing on the ceramic tile blank executing color development fabric after at 1210 DEG C
Burn till rear tested inks color development.
2, ink bleed depth experiments: ink is respectively charged into from permeation-promoter in the different passage of ink jet printer;According to formulating ash
Ink and permeation-promoter are printed on the ceramic body executing color development fabric by degree combination simultaneously;After printing completes, after dry base substrate
In 1210 DEG C calcine 70 minutes, after product is cleaved under optical microscope tested inks length of penetration.
Above two experiment conditions: ink-jet printer is new Jingtai experimental ink-jet machine, shower nozzle is Xaar1002 GS440 shower nozzle,
In above-described embodiment, the composition (by mass percentage) of color development fabric is: SiO2 70%、Al2O3 21%、Na2O 4.5%、K2O
2%、CaO 0.5%、ZrO22%, wherein in above-mentioned material, nanometer ZrO2Account for 2%, Nano-meter SiO_22Account for 3%, say, that ZrO2All
For nanometer ZrO2, and SiO2Having fraction is Nano-meter SiO_22。
It should be noted that, L* represents brightness (Luminosity), and a* represents from carmetta to green scope, b* represent from
Yellow is to blue scope, and the codomain of a* and b* is all by+127 to-128.Because being two ink channels, each passage is 0-
100%, so above-mentioned gray scale combination sum is 110%.Can be seen that the present embodiment test effect is the most bright-coloured, no from a* and b* value
Bright-coloured performance is that b* value is generally less than 35.
